In Italy’s original coffee houses, coffee was usually brewed Turkish style, boiled with spices and sugar in a heated pot. Each cup of Turkish coffee took around five minutes to prepare, not counting the time it took to cool down enough for customers to enjoy it.

Web23 jun. 2024 · Espresso (/ɛˈsprɛsoʊ/ ( listen), Italian: [eˈsprɛsso]) is a coffee-brewing method of Italian origin , in which a small amount of nearly boiling water (about 90 °C or 190 °F) is forced under 9–10 bars (900–1,000 kPa; 130–150 psi) of pressure through finely-ground coffee beans.
